Market Overview

The AI-based clinical trials solution provider market covers technologies and services that embed artificial intelligence into the clinical development lifecycle, from protocol design and patient identification to site monitoring and data management. It was valued at approximately USD 2.77 billion in 2025 and is forecast to compound at roughly 25.85% per year through the next decade. The market sits at the intersection of healthcare IT, life sciences R&D outsourcing, and advanced analytics, addressing long-standing pain points such as patient recruitment delays, protocol amendments, and data overload.

  • Estimated 2025 valuation of about USD 2.77 billion with a projected CAGR near 25.85%
  • Long-term forecast reaching roughly USD 20.17 billion by 2035
  • Solutions span trial design, patient recruitment, remote monitoring, and data analytics

Growth Drivers

Escalating R&D costs and lengthy development timelines in the pharmaceutical industry are pushing sponsors and CROs toward AI-driven efficiencies across trial operations. Regulatory acceptance of digital and decentralized trial models, alongside the explosion of structured and unstructured healthcare data, is enabling more sophisticated AI applications. Additionally, the rise of precision medicine and biomarker-driven trials requires advanced pattern recognition and predictive modeling that AI tools are uniquely positioned to deliver.

  • Rising demand to reduce trial timelines, recruitment failures, and protocol amendments
  • Increasing availability of electronic health records, genomics, and real-world data fueling AI model development
  • Growing adoption of decentralized and virtual trial models supported by AI-enabled platforms

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market is commonly segmented by therapeutic application, clinical trial phase, component (software, services), deployment model, and end user, with p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ies representing the largest end-user category. By region, North America accounts for the dominant share thanks to a dense concentration of biopharma sponsors, mature regulatory frameworks, and significant venture investment. Europe holds the second-largest share, while Asia-Pacific is projected to be the fastest-growing region due to expanding clinical research activity in China, India, and South Korea.

  • North America leads on the back of strong sponsor presence, regulatory maturity, and funding activity
  •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region, driven by expanding trial activity and government support
  • Key therapeutic focus areas include oncology, cardiovascular, neurology, and infectious diseases

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

Generative AI is rapidly being applied to trial protocol drafting, clinical study reports, and regulatory document preparation, while predictive AI is being embedded into patient recruitment and retention workflows. Synthetic control arms, AI-driven site selection, and real-time safety monitoring are moving from pilot deployments to broader adoption across late-phase studies. Over the coming decade, the market is expected to be shaped by tighter integration of AI with real-world evidence platforms, expanding use of federated learning across trial sites, and continued regulatory engagement around the validation of AI-based decision support.

  • Generative AI is being adopted for protocol authoring, study reports, and regulatory submissions
  • Use of synthetic control arms and AI-driven site/patient selection is scaling across late-phase trials
  • Regulatory guidance on AI in clinical development will be a key determinant of long-term market maturity
